Allegheny Commons (Park)
Brighton Rd & Ridge AveAllegheny Commons is most popular around 12 PM on Saturdays. It's most quiet on Tuesdays.
Established in 1867, Allegheny Commons is Pittsburgh's oldest park. Known for its mature canopy trees, wide promenade, and lovely Lake Elizabeth, Allegheny Commons is the front yard for the Northside's diverse neighborhoods.
